[闲聊] Nim 好像不错...

楼主: Neisseria (Neisseria)   2017-09-03 12:36:58
最近偶然间看到的,一个新的编译语言
Nim 程式码会编译成 C 程式码,然后再用 C 编译成执行档
有一些类似 Python 和其他高阶语言的语法
有 GC,感觉有点和 D、Go、Rust 的领域重叠
不过,社群好像比 Rust 小,而且语言还没上 1.0 正式版
现阶段暂时不会马上跳坑,这一阵子先继续用 Go 好了
BTW,最近出现好几个新的编译语言:Go、Rust、Nim、Crystal、Pony...
早几年有这些好东西就好了,厂厂
作者: eye5002003 (下一夜)   2017-09-03 14:04:00
这不是我之前寻找的东西吗?可惜我现在没有用C了
作者: ronin728 (浪人)   2017-09-03 17:04:00
其实编译到C的语言好早以前就有,不过大家不喜欢就是了
作者: dododavid006 (朔雪)   2017-09-03 17:22:00
编译成 C 的语言还有一个由 Gnome 推出的 Vala
作者: soheadsome (师大狗鼻哥)   2017-09-03 17:53:00
gnome不是要改用rust吗
作者: uranusjr (←這人是超級笨蛋)   2017-09-03 22:04:00
Vala 我还满爱的但社群一直起不来, 找不到除了 GTK 之外的用途, 偏偏 GTK 除了 Gnome 外的发展又超渣
作者: Schottky (顺风相送)   2017-09-03 22:45:00
早期语言很多是先编译成 C,省下跨平台的力气比如说 Pascal 和 C++ 等等
作者: CoNsTaR ((const *))   2017-09-04 00:57:00
也可以试试 Idris,目前 1.1.1,个人很喜欢可以编成 C 或 javascript 和一大堆其他语言不过有些后端只靠社群努力,最实用的还是 C 或 js
作者: soheadsome (师大狗鼻哥)   2017-09-04 07:58:00
cfront:
作者: johnny94 (32767)   2017-09-04 08:42:00
感觉这些语言目前有玩起来的只有 Go 跟 rust该说有大公司在背后撑腰有差吗?

Links booklink

Contact Us: admin [ a t ] ucptt.com